Ackerbroeck Bart Vanden, had the strong desire to trek to the Everest Base Camp 5357m. This year his desire got fulfilled with Explore Himalaya. He was here with us on October 26, 2012. He had the perfect sightseeing arrangement around the Kathmandu city on 27th. On 28 October, his trek was scheduled to Phakding after the short flight to Lukla. A night at Phakding followed the trek to Namche on 29 October. He had a day rest at Namche. On 31st, he had the long way to Tyangboche.

October came to an end and on the first of November, he trekked to Pheriche 4252m. From Periche his journey, closer to EBC was planned. Hence he wished to have a day break at Periche. On November 3, he ascended to Lobuche 4930m in an average pace. He came very close to EBC, at Gorakshep 5184m on fourth. November 5, he was at the Everest Base Camp and made the prompt U-turn back to Gorakshep after witnessing the fantastic enough time at EBC. From Gorakshep he then started descending towards Lukla Airport via Pangboche and Namche.. On November 9, he took the flight back to Kathmandu from Lukla and made his exit from Nepal on November 10.
